Lagan Construction move into Fairways
The Muir Group has let 5,687 sq ft of office accommodation at Fairways Business Park, Livingston to Lagan Construction, one of the UK's leading Civil Engineering businesses.
The company deals with infrastructure, capital and maintenance projects for both the private and public sectors. With over 45 year experience the company, established in Ireland, covers both the UK and international markets. Lagan is relocating from their previous accommodation in Fife in order to facilitate the expansion of the business.
Peter I'Anson of Ryden, who represents the Muir Group at Fairways, comments: "Despite what is widely regarded as being the toughest occupational market in recent years, this letting to Lagan proves there is still activity"

DOBBIES GARDEN CENTRE AT FAIRWAYS BUSINESS PARK
Muir Property Investments are delighted to announce the sale of 10 acres at Beughburn to Dobbies Garden Centre which is situated at Junction 3 of the M8 motorway and diagonally opposite Fairways Business Park,Livingston.
Dobbies will create a 60,000 sq ft Garden centre which will sit alongside a mixed used development of commercial, business and leisure land uses.

Bathgate to Airdrie line is on track
THE FIRST length of railway track was laid on the Bathgate to Airdrie line this week.
A track laying ceremony was held on Monday and saw the first piece of the 15-mile line put in place as the major project enters a crucial phase.
The tracks, laid just to the west of the town’s station, will link the existing Bathgate to Edinburgh and Airdrie to Glasgow lines by autumn this year.
It is expected that passenger services will be operating on the track by December.
The track laying ceremony followed 18 months of rigorous activity.

Barr Bags £35 Million Sainsbury's Contracts
Barr Construction, one of the UK’s leading construction companies, has through its retail division secured a series of contracts worth £35 million from Sainsbury’s, which has embarked on an ambitious expansion programme in Scotland.
The contracts will see Barr’s retail division construct two new stores, oversee two store extensions and one store conversion for the supermarket chain. Barr will also be responsible for the construction of Sainsbury’s convenience store programme throughout Scotland.
Barr will begin work in the summer of 2010 on a new 25,000 sq ft (sales) store in Hawick, having recently delivered a new 30,000sq ft store in Strathaven.
The company will add an extra 25,000 sq ft to the existing Sainsbury’s store in Hamilton and will extend the supermarket’s Darnley store, which on completion in October 2010 will have a 100,000 sq ft sales floor, making it Sainsbury’s largest store in Scotland.
